ca_certs in httplib2 #100

Because of new browser rules, I had to install local certificate authority and make localhost available via https for testing. I think it will be more common in the future. For using the locally-issued certificate, httplib2 has a parameter ca_certs; however, it cannot be available through pylti. I solved the problem with monkey patching; however, it seems awkward:

import httplib2
old_init = httplib2.Http.__init__
def new_init(self, *args, **kwargs):
    """Call the original __init__ function with the certificate."""
    old_init(self, *args, **kwargs, ca_certs=ROOT_CERTIFICATE_PATH)
httplib2.Http.__init__ = new_init

Maybe PYLTI_CONFIG could take ca_certs and pass to httplib2:

app.config['PYLTI_CONFIG'] = {
    'consumers': {CONSUMER_KEY: {'secret': CONSUMER_SECRET}},
    'ca_certs': ROOT_CERTIFICATE_PATH,
}
